FAQs

Should we switch from our gas furnace to a heat pump given our winter lows?

Modern cold-climate heat pumps are effective in Canutillo, where winter lows rarely challenge their lower operational limit. The economic case is strong: combining the federal rebate with El Paso Electric's efficiency program rebates ($300-$800) lowers the installation cost. Since electricity rates are $0.11/kWh, operating a heat pump during off-peak hours (outside 2 PM to 8 PM) for both heating and cooling can be more cost-effective than maintaining separate gas and electric systems.

What permits and new rules apply to a 2026 AC installation?

All HVAC replacements in El Paso County require a mechanical permit from the Planning and Development Department. For 2026, the critical update involves the safe handling of A2L refrigerants like R-454B, which are mildly flammable. New standards mandate specialized technician certification, leak detection systems, and updated labeling for any system containing these refrigerants. Using a licensed contractor ensures the installation meets these updated codes for safety and eligibility for all available rebates.

Our Ecobee thermostat is showing an 'E4' alert. What does that mean here?

An Ecobee E4 code specifically indicates a loss of communication with the outdoor AC unit or heat pump. In Canutillo, the most common root cause is not electronic failure but a safety lockout triggered by the system. This is often due to high pressure from a dirty condenser coil clogged with desert dust or low pressure from a refrigerant leak. The alert is a predictive signal that the system has shut down to prevent compressor damage, requiring a technician to diagnose the underlying mechanical issue.

Our house was built around 2000. Is our AC unit likely to fail soon?

A system installed in 2000 is now 26 years old, which is well beyond the 12-15 year service life expected for this region. Units of this age in Canutillo are especially prone to evaporator coil scaling. The hard water prevalent in our area combines with high dust particulates to form a mineral crust on the coil's aluminum fins. This acts as an insulator, drastically reducing heat transfer and causing the compressor to overwork, which is a primary failure mode for older systems.

Why does our AC struggle when it gets above 101 degrees?

Residential systems in Canutillo are typically designed for a 101°F outdoor temperature, the local design temp. When ambient air exceeds this limit, the system's capacity to reject heat diminishes. The temperature differential, or delta T, the system can achieve shrinks. The newer R-454B refrigerant standard for 2026 offers slightly better high-temperature performance and lower global warming potential than older R-410A, but all systems will see reduced efficiency and capacity during our most extreme summer days.

What does the new 14.3 SEER2 minimum mean for my electricity bill?

The 2026 federal SEER2 standard mandates a 14.3 minimum efficiency, a significant jump from older units rated at 10-13 SEER. At the local utility rate of $0.11 per kWh, upgrading from a 13 SEER to an 18 SEER2 system can reduce cooling costs by approximately 30%. The active Inflation Reduction Act rebates, offering up to $8,000 for a qualified heat pump installation, can effectively offset the higher initial cost of these efficient systems, making the payback period in Canutillo very favorable.

Can our existing ducts handle a high-MERV filter for the ozone and pollen?

Your galvanized sheet metal ducts with external fiberglass wrap have a smooth interior that generally supports better airflow than flex duct. However, installing a MERV-13 filter for ozone precursors and April pollen requires a static pressure check. An oversized filter cabinet or a restrictive filter can strain the blower motor. We recommend a professional measurement; often, a MERV-11 filter paired with a dedicated air purifier provides optimal air quality without compromising system performance in this arid climate.
